会员地址测试用例
一、添加会员地址测试用例
校验项 |
预期code |
预期消息 |
收货人为空校验 |
004 |
收货人姓名不能为空 |
详细地址为空校验 |
004 |
详细地址不能为空 |
手机号码为空校验 |
004 |
手机号码格式不正确 |
是否为默认地址参数为空校验 |
004 |
是否为默认地址参数错误 |
是否为默认地址参数为-1,合法性校验 |
004 |
是否为默认地址参数错误 |
是否为默认地址参数为2,合法性校验 |
004 |
是否为默认地址参数错误 |
手机号码格式校验 |
004 |
手机号码格式不正确 |
会员是否存在校验 |
003 |
当前会员不存在 |
对会员地址上限测试,最多为20个地址 |
100 |
会员地址已达20个上限,无法添加 |
正确性校验 |
http状态为200 |
校验添加后的数据是否符合预期 |
二、修改会员地址测试用例
校验项 |
预期code |
预期消息 |
收货人为空校验 |
004 |
收货人姓名不能为空 |
详细地址为空校验 |
004 |
详细地址不能为空 |
手机号码为空校验 |
004 |
手机号码格式不正确 |
是否为默认地址参数为空校验 |
004 |
是否为默认地址参数错误 |
是否为默认地址参数为-1,合法性校验 |
004 |
是否为默认地址参数错误 |
是否为默认地址参数为2,合法性校验 |
004 |
是否为默认地址参数错误 |
手机号码格式校验 |
004 |
手机号码格式不正确 |
会员是否存在校验 |
003 |
当前会员不存在 |
要修改的地址是否存在校验 |
002 |
无权限操作此地址 |
默认地址修改为非默认地址校验 |
101 |
无法更改当前默认地址为非默认人地址 |
修改其他会员地址校验 |
002 |
无权限操作此地址 |
正确性校验 |
预期http状态为200 |
校验修改后的数据是否符合预期 |
三、删除会员地址测试用例
校验项 |
预期code |
预期消息 |
删除不存在的会员地址 |
002 |
无权限操作此地址 |
删除其他人的会员地址 |
002 |
无权限操作此地址 |
正确测试 |
http状态200 |
校验删除后此地址是否还存在 |
四、设置默认地址测试用例
校验项 |
预期code |
预期消息 |
地址不存在校验 |
002 |
权限不足 |
设置其他人的会员地址为默认地址 |
002 |
权限不足 |
正确测试 |
http状态200 |